Understanding the Basics: Seconds and Minutes
Before we tackle 400 seconds, let's establish a firm foundation. Time is measured using a standardized system based on seconds, minutes, hours, days, and so on. The fundamental relationship we need to grasp is:
1 minute = 60 seconds
This simple equation is the key to unlocking all time conversions. It tells us that every minute contains 60 individual seconds. Think of it like a minute being a container that holds 60 smaller units of time – seconds. Imagine counting to 60 – that’s the length of one minute!

3. What if I need to convert seconds to hours? You would first convert seconds to minutes (divide by 60), and then convert minutes to hours (divide by 60 again).
4. Why is the 60-second minute system used? The 60-second minute system is derived from the Babylonian sexagesimal (base-60) numeral system, which was adopted and refined over centuries.
